MySqlLinkedService interface
MySQL veri kaynağı için bağlı hizmet.
- Extends
Özellikler
| allow |
Bu, 0000-00-00-00 özel "sıfır" tarih değerinin veritabanından alınmasına olanak tanır. Tür: boole. |
| connection |
Bağlantı dizesi. Tür: string, SecureString veya AzureKeyVaultSecretReference. |
| connection |
Denemeyi sonlandırmadan ve hata oluşturmadan önce sunucu bağlantısını bekleme süresi (saniye cinsinden). Tür: tamsayı. |
| convert |
İzin verilmeyen değerlere sahip tarih veya tarih saat sütunları için DateTime.MinValue döndürmek için True. Tür: boole. |
| database | Bağlantı için veritabanı adı. Tür: dize. |
| driver |
MySQL sürücüsünün sürümü. Tür: dize. Eski sürücü için V1 veya boş, yeni sürücü için V2. V1, bağlantı dizesini ve özellik çantasını destekleyebilir, V2 yalnızca bağlantı dizesini destekleyebilir. |
| encrypted |
Kimlik doğrulaması için kullanılan şifrelenmiş kimlik bilgileri. Kimlik bilgileri tümleştirme çalışma zamanı kimlik bilgisi yöneticisi kullanılarak şifrelenir. Tür: dize. |
| guid |
Hangi sütun türünün (varsa) GUID olarak okunması gerektiğini belirler. Tür: dize. Yok: Hiçbir sütun türü otomatik olarak Guid olarak okunmaz; Char36: Tüm CHAR(36) sütunları, UUID ile eşleşen kısa çizgili küçük harf onaltılık değerleri kullanılarak Guid olarak okunur/yazılır. |
| password | Bağlantı dizesindeki parolanın Azure anahtar kasası gizli dizisi başvurusu. |
| port | Bağlantının bağlantı noktası. Tür: tamsayı. |
| server | Bağlantı için sunucu adı. Tür: dize. |
| ssl |
İstemcinin SSL sertifika dosyasının PEM biçimindeki yolu. SslKey de belirtilmelidir. Tür: dize. |
| ssl |
PEM biçiminde istemcinin SSL özel anahtarının yolu. SslCert de belirtilmelidir. Tür: dize. |
| ssl |
Bağlantı için SSL modu. Tür: tamsayı. 0: Devre Dışı Bırak, 1: Tercih Et, 2: Gerektir, 3: Doğrula-CA, 4: Doğrula-Tam. |
| treat |
true olarak ayarlandığında TINYINT(1) değerleri boole olarak döndürülür. Tür: bool. |
| type | Bu nesnenin olabileceği farklı türleri belirten polimorfik ayrımcı |
| username | Kimlik doğrulaması için kullanıcı adı. Tür: dize. |
| use |
Bağlantı için sistem güven deposu kullanın. Tür: tamsayı. 0: etkinleştir, 1: devre dışı bırak. |
Devralınan Özellikler
| annotations | Bağlı hizmeti tanımlamak için kullanılabilecek etiketlerin listesi. |
| connect |
Tümleştirme çalışma zamanı başvurusu. |
| description | Bağlı hizmet açıklaması. |
| parameters | Bağlı hizmet için parametreler. |
| version | Bağlı hizmetin sürümü. |
Özellik Ayrıntıları
allowZeroDateTime
Bu, 0000-00-00-00 özel "sıfır" tarih değerinin veritabanından alınmasına olanak tanır. Tür: boole.
allowZeroDateTime?: any
Özellik Değeri
any
connectionString
Bağlantı dizesi. Tür: string, SecureString veya AzureKeyVaultSecretReference.
connectionString?: any
Özellik Değeri
any
connectionTimeout
Denemeyi sonlandırmadan ve hata oluşturmadan önce sunucu bağlantısını bekleme süresi (saniye cinsinden). Tür: tamsayı.
connectionTimeout?: any
Özellik Değeri
any
convertZeroDateTime
İzin verilmeyen değerlere sahip tarih veya tarih saat sütunları için DateTime.MinValue döndürmek için True. Tür: boole.
convertZeroDateTime?: any
Özellik Değeri
any
database
Bağlantı için veritabanı adı. Tür: dize.
database?: any
Özellik Değeri
any
driverVersion
MySQL sürücüsünün sürümü. Tür: dize. Eski sürücü için V1 veya boş, yeni sürücü için V2. V1, bağlantı dizesini ve özellik çantasını destekleyebilir, V2 yalnızca bağlantı dizesini destekleyebilir.
driverVersion?: any
Özellik Değeri
any
encryptedCredential
Kimlik doğrulaması için kullanılan şifrelenmiş kimlik bilgileri. Kimlik bilgileri tümleştirme çalışma zamanı kimlik bilgisi yöneticisi kullanılarak şifrelenir. Tür: dize.
encryptedCredential?: string
Özellik Değeri
string
guidFormat
Hangi sütun türünün (varsa) GUID olarak okunması gerektiğini belirler. Tür: dize. Yok: Hiçbir sütun türü otomatik olarak Guid olarak okunmaz; Char36: Tüm CHAR(36) sütunları, UUID ile eşleşen kısa çizgili küçük harf onaltılık değerleri kullanılarak Guid olarak okunur/yazılır.
guidFormat?: any
Özellik Değeri
any
password
Bağlantı dizesindeki parolanın Azure anahtar kasası gizli dizisi başvurusu.
password?: AzureKeyVaultSecretReference
Özellik Değeri
port
Bağlantının bağlantı noktası. Tür: tamsayı.
port?: any
Özellik Değeri
any
server
Bağlantı için sunucu adı. Tür: dize.
server?: any
Özellik Değeri
any
sslCert
İstemcinin SSL sertifika dosyasının PEM biçimindeki yolu. SslKey de belirtilmelidir. Tür: dize.
sslCert?: any
Özellik Değeri
any
sslKey
PEM biçiminde istemcinin SSL özel anahtarının yolu. SslCert de belirtilmelidir. Tür: dize.
sslKey?: any
Özellik Değeri
any
sslMode
Bağlantı için SSL modu. Tür: tamsayı. 0: Devre Dışı Bırak, 1: Tercih Et, 2: Gerektir, 3: Doğrula-CA, 4: Doğrula-Tam.
sslMode?: any
Özellik Değeri
any
treatTinyAsBoolean
true olarak ayarlandığında TINYINT(1) değerleri boole olarak döndürülür. Tür: bool.
treatTinyAsBoolean?: any
Özellik Değeri
any
type
Bu nesnenin olabileceği farklı türleri belirten polimorfik ayrımcı
type: "MySql"
Özellik Değeri
"MySql"
username
Kimlik doğrulaması için kullanıcı adı. Tür: dize.
username?: any
Özellik Değeri
any
useSystemTrustStore
Bağlantı için sistem güven deposu kullanın. Tür: tamsayı. 0: etkinleştir, 1: devre dışı bırak.
useSystemTrustStore?: any
Özellik Değeri
any
Devralınan Özellik Detayları
annotations
Bağlı hizmeti tanımlamak için kullanılabilecek etiketlerin listesi.
annotations?: any[]
Özellik Değeri
any[]
LinkedService.annotationsDevralındı
connectVia
Tümleştirme çalışma zamanı başvurusu.
connectVia?: IntegrationRuntimeReference
Özellik Değeri
description
Bağlı hizmet açıklaması.
description?: string
Özellik Değeri
string
parameters
Bağlı hizmet için parametreler.
parameters?: {[propertyName: string]: ParameterSpecification}
Özellik Değeri
{[propertyName: string]: ParameterSpecification}
version
Bağlı hizmetin sürümü.
version?: string
Özellik Değeri
string